Introducing V&A East

V&A East, one of London's latest cultural additions, officially opened its doors on April 18, 2026. This exciting destination promises to offer a wealth of enriching experiences for art and culture enthusiasts. V&A East is not just a museum; it is a community hub where visitors can learn about and explore diverse artworks from around the globe.

Spaces within the Museum

The museum comprises two main areas: V&A Storehouse and V&A East Museum. V&A Storehouse allows visitors to request access to millions of valuable artifacts, while V&A East Museum will feature both permanent collections and temporary exhibitions. This initiative is part of the Victoria and Albert Museum's efforts to expand its reach, which has been in existence since 1857.

Connecting with the Community

V&A East's director, Gus Casely-Hayford, emphasizes the museum's goal of engaging with the surrounding community. They have conducted numerous discussions in schools to understand the needs and desires of local residents. This approach not only aids the museum's development but also fosters a friendly and accessible environment.

Special Exhibition: The Music is Black

One of the standout exhibitions at V&A East is "The Music is Black," which explores 125 years of Black music in the UK. This exhibition is divided into four sections, each corresponding to a different musical theme. The emotions of music from various eras are brought to life through recordings and displayed artifacts, highlighting the significance of music in contemporary culture.

Other Highlights of the Museum

During your visit, you'll have the chance to admire unique items, such as the piano of Winifred Atwell, a British artist of Trinidadian descent. The museum doesn't stop at instruments; it also showcases performance costumes worn by famous artists like Seal and Shirley Bassey.

Useful Information for Vietnamese Travelers

To visit London and explore V&A East, you'll need to prepare a UK tourist visa. Typically, a tourist visa costs around 3 million VND for short stays. Flight prices from Vietnam (SGN or HAN) to London range from 15 million to 30 million VND, depending on the time of booking. The best travel season in London is from April to August, when the weather is warm and numerous cultural events take place.
